SemVer 計算ツール

セマンティックバージョニング(SemVer)の解析・比較・バンプ・範囲チェックができるオンラインツール。npm/yarn開発に最適。

有効なSemVer
Major
1
Minor
2
Patch
3
Prerelease: beta.4
Build: build.567
正規化: 1.2.3-beta.4+build.567

セマンティックバージョニングとは?

セマンティックバージョニング(SemVer)は、ソフトウェアのバージョン番号をMAJOR.MINOR.PATCHの形式で管理する規約です。npm、yarn、Cargo など主要なパッケージマネージャーで採用されています。

  • Major: 後方互換性のない変更
  • Minor: 後方互換性のある機能追加
  • Patch: 後方互換性のあるバグ修正

プレリリース版は 1.0.0-alpha.1 のように ハイフンに続けて識別子を付与します。ビルドメタデータは + 以降に記述します。

このツールをもっと活用する

もっと学びたい方へ

チートシート・技術記事・開発リソースで学習を加速